Department Store Closures Include Four Michigan Locations

Macy’s released a list of closures. Four Michigan stores made the cut. These include:

  • Oakland Mall in Troy
  • Lakeside Mall in Sterling Heights
  • Genesee Valley Center in Flint
  • Grand Traverse Mall in Traverse City

Lakeside Mall already shut down in July 2024. Macy’s stayed open a little longer. Now, it will close for good. Clearance sales start in January. They will last 8-12 weeks. Macy’s has not set an exact closing date.

Department Store Downsizing Continues as More Locations Close

Macy’s isn’t finished yet. It plans to close 150 stores nationwide. That will leave just 350 Macy’s locations in the U.S.. The company is taking a risk. It believes fewer, stronger locations will keep it in business.
